If you were not aware, the last two financial years has been very ordinary for new and used boat sales, however there are many signs that things might be finally starting to turn around due to the improvement in the AUD over the Euro, interest rates peaking, new policies detering investment into certain assets and a lot more second hand yachts reducing their asking price to meet the current market value.
Furthermore, there have been a number of new models from manufacturers that have arrived recently that have created a lot of renewed interest in sailing yachts and catamarans.
